#BRES Blencowe Resources PLC – Successful Hypersonic Rocket Testing
Blencowe Resources Plc (LSE: BRES) is pleased to report further successful testing of Orom-Cross graphite products within advanced aerospace and defence applications.
On 18 August 2026 American Energy Technologies Co (“AETC”), Pluto Aerospace, Purdue University and US Government Agencies, together with Blencowe COO Iain Wearing, attended a rocket test programme in Las Cruces, New Mexico. The successful Pluto Aerospace solid-fuel rocket flight achieved a maximum speed of Mach 5.5 and acceleration approaching 150G, representing a substantial increase in speed and acceleration from the previous test programme undertaken in April.
Importantly, Orom-Cross graphite was incorporated across multiple critical components aboard the hypersonic vehicle, including an ablative rocket nozzle insert, performance-enhancing coatings applied to the rocket fins and natural graphite used within the lithium-ion battery powering the rocket’s altimeter.
The successful test further demonstrates the potential for Orom-Cross graphite to access specialist, high-value aerospace and defence markets, supporting Blencowe’s strategy to continually develop higher-value product pathways as Orom-Cross advances towards production.

Blencowe provided graphite concentrates from Orom-Cross to technical partner AETC, which manufactured mouldings for rocket and missile exhaust nozzles replacing a proportion of the synthetic graphites normally used in these applications. The resultant nozzles underwent rigorous testing prior to installation on the rocket.
The initial testing programme is being undertaken with Pluto Aerospace for hypersonic sub-orbital rockets, with orbital testing planned for the final quarter of 2026.
The successful flight conducted on 18 August 2026 utilised a substantially larger motor than the previous test undertaken in April, achieving a maximum speed of Mach 5.5 and acceleration approaching 150G.
In addition to the highly innovative rocket motor, Orom-Cross graphite was incorporated into several important components aboard the hypersonic vehicle:
· an advanced ablative nozzle insert manufactured by AETC for enhanced thrust performance;
· performance-enhancing anti-friction and ice-phobic coatings applied to the rocket’s four aluminium fins; and
· natural graphite used within the lithium-ion battery powering the rocket’s altimeter.
Of special note is the application of 3.8 Ah pouch cells, manufactured by Navitas Systems incorporating manufactured natural graphite supplied by Blencowe together with recycled graphite produced through AETC’s direct recycling process. The battery incorporated up to 15 wt.% recycled and “healed” graphite produced through AETC’s direct recycling process and represents the first known example in the North American battery industry of a fully functional form-factored battery incorporating industrially manufactured recycled graphite as a significant component of both the active material and cathode conductivity additive.
Importantly, the battery, comprised of 100% natural flake graphite from raw and recycled materials, with no synthetic graphites, further demonstrating the potential for Orom-Cross graphite to be utilised within specialist, high-value military and aerospace applications.
With the launch of this rocket, Pluto Aerospace and AETC highlighted a group of trusted vendors and raw material suppliers involved in the programme, including Navitas Systems, an advanced U.S. battery manufacturer; Blencowe Resources plc, the supplier of Orom-Cross graphite used in rocket nozzles, battery and ice phobic coatings aboard the flight; and Cadoux Limited, a supplier of nanoscale alumina used as a critical safety component of lithium-ion batteries.

#BRES Blencowe Resources PLC – Rocket Component Testing Programme
Blencowe Resources Plc (LSE: BRES) is pleased to announce that graphite concentrate from its Orom-Cross Graphite Project in Uganda has been used in a rocket component testing programme in the United States (California), with the initial test firing successfully completed and early observations indicating encouraging performance in high-temperature applications.
The Company provided Orom-Cross graphite concentrates to American Energy Technologies Company (“AETC”) who manufactured mouldings designed for use in rocket propulsion nozzles, including defence-related test applications. These nozzles were developed to evaluate the replacement of a percentage of the synthetic graphite typically used in such components and to assess the suitability of Orom-Cross material in high-temperature environments.
A recent test firing programme was attended by representatives from Pluto Aerospace, Purdue University and various US Government Agencies alongside Blencowe’s Chief Operating Officer Iain Wearing. The programme successfully completed the planned test runs, and data is now being analysed by the parties involved. Blencowe expects to provide further updates as additional milestones are reached.
The testing application was conducted with Pluto Aerospace on its hypersonic sub-orbital rocket platform in the initial programme. Further testing is planned and, subject to programme scheduling and technical outcomes, orbital testing is expected in the latter half of 2026.
In parallel, AETC has also been testing graphite-based coatings applied to rocket fin components to evaluate durability under hypersonic conditions and icephobic properties (surfaces designed to repel ice, prevent ice formation, or significantly reduce ice adhesion), with potential applicability across military and civilian aircraft environments. While the recorded data remains under analysis, initial observational performance has been encouraging, and the Company will update the market as results become available.

Atlantic View – Rolls Royce has the tools to engineer a recovery

by John Woolfitt, Atlantic Capital Markets
Rolls Royce has the tools to engineer a recovery.
Fundamentals & Statement Summary

Aero engineering giant Rolls-Royce (RR.) this morning unveiled interim results for H1 2020, and reported a significant H1 impact from COVID-19, adding that the timing and shape of industry recovery remains uncertain. The group reported a 24% fall in underlying revenues of £5.6bn, down 24%, and an operating loss of £1.7bn including one-off charges of £1.2bn in Civil Aerospace, largely related to COVID-19. The reported loss before tax of £5.4bn included a £2.6bn non-cash loss from the revaluation of the FX hedge book, reflecting lower forecast US$ receipts.
Rolls also reported good liquidity of £6.1bn comprising £4.2bn of cash at 30 June, and a £1.9bn undrawn revolving credit facility (RCF). A further £2bn undrawn term loan was also announced in July and finalised in August. The group ended H1 with net debt of £1.7bn excluding lease liabilities (FY 2019 net cash of £1.4bn).
The group reported successful actions to reduce costs, with £350m delivered in H1 towards a 2020 target of £1bn. These actions included a fundamental restructuring of Civil Aerospace, with a 4,000 group headcount reduction by 27 August, with further potential disposals expected to raise at least £2bn, including ITP Aero and other assets.
The Board decided that given the uncertain macro outlook they would no longer be recommending a final shareholder payment of 7.1 pence per share in respect of 2019, resulting in cash savings equivalent to £137m. For the same reasons, the Board has not approved an interim shareholder payment for 2020. A range of options to further strengthen the balance sheet are currently under review.

Chart and Technicals

Source: FactSet and Hargreaves Lansdown
In line with aerospace industry stocks and the majority of FTSE100 constituents, RR shares fell sharply through February and into March, twice bouncing off a 250p then multi-year low. Despite recovering and punching back above the 50-day moving average in May, the stock succumbed again at the start of July, trading below the yellow MA envelope, even briefly dipping below 250p to set a new multi-year low at 212p before recovering in the run up to the results. The NVI (negative volume index (traded volume to determine trend strength or confirm a price movement) has improved since the end of June, and if RR can ‘climb back’ into the price range envelope after the results today, and in the process regain the 50-day moving average, then recovery of the falling 200-day MA is possible, although expect a retest of 212p multi-year lows before any sustained recovery.
